A bill to correct an error in the enrollment of the Consolidated Appropriations Act, 2010.

Introduced: March 10, 2010 Introduced by: Wicker, Roger F. Republican · Mississippi See on congress.gov
This bill died when the 111th Congress ended
It never became law before the 111th Congress (2009–2010) adjourned, and bills don't carry over to the next Congress. It would have to be reintroduced. You can still save it for reference, but it won't receive updates.

 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Makes a technical correction in the enrollment of the Consolidated Appropriations Act, 2010 with respect to the National Railroad Passenger Corporation (Amtrak) report to Congress on Amtrak's proposed guidance and procedures necessary for it to implement a new checked firearms program.

Requires the scope of such guidance and procedures to include any other measures needed to ensure the safety and security of Amtrak employees, passengers, and infrastructure, including: (1) requiring inspections of any container that carries a firearm or ammunition; and (2) the temporary suspension of firearm carriage service if credible intelligence information indicates a threat related to the national rail system or specific routes or trains.
